What Is a GPS Repeater?

A GPS repeater receives GPS signals from an external antenna and retransmits them indoors or in signal-blocked environments.

It is commonly used in:

  • Industrial facilities
  • Warehouses
  • Underground parking areas
  • Construction machinery
  • Mining operations
  • Fleet vehicles
  • Marine systems
  • Testing laboratories

If your project requires consistent GPS positioning in areas where signals are weak, a repeater is often the most practical solution.

Step 1: Identify Your Application Environment

Before buying a GPS repeater online, clearly define your project:

Indoor Industrial Use

  • Warehouses
  • Manufacturing plants
  • Research labs

Look for stable indoor signal coverage and appropriate antenna cable length.

Vehicle or Fleet Installation

  • Trucks
  • Construction equipment
  • Emergency vehicles

Choose compact, vibration-resistant models.

Harsh Environments

  • Mining
  • Outdoor construction
  • Marine applications

Select rugged GPS repeaters with durable enclosures.

Step 2: Check Signal Coverage & Gain

One of the most important factors when buying online is signal gain and coverage area.

Compare:

✔ Coverage radius
✔ Signal strength (gain level)
✔ Noise figure
✔ Amplification stability

Buying a repeater with insufficient gain may result in weak indoor coverage.

Step 3: Verify Compatibility

Before checkout, confirm compatibility with:

  • Your GPS receiver
  • GNSS systems (GPS, GLONASS, Galileo if required)
  • Antenna type
  • Power supply requirements

Not all repeaters support multi-constellation GNSS systems. If your project requires broader satellite coverage, choose a compatible model.

Step 4: Consider Installation Requirements

When buying a GPS repeater online, review installation needs:

  • External antenna placement
  • Cable length
  • Indoor antenna positioning
  • Mounting options
  • Power source (USB, DC input, etc.)

Make sure your installation environment supports proper signal routing.

Step 5: Check Regulatory Compliance

GPS repeaters must comply with local regulations in certain regions.

Before purchasing:

✔ Confirm regulatory approval
✔ Verify frequency compliance
✔ Ensure legal usage in your country

Buying from a specialized supplier reduces compliance risks.

Step 6: Compare Industrial vs Consumer Models

Consumer-grade GPS repeaters may work for home or car use but are not suitable for industrial projects.

Industrial-grade models offer:

  • Better shielding
  • Stable amplification
  • Higher durability
  • Long-term availability
  • Technical documentation

For professional applications, reliability is more important than low price.
